Panama is a growing market for textiles and clothing products. Exports of Indian MMF textiles to Panama have been steadily growing during 2015-16. Panama is also a potential market for other textile products like apparel, cotton and silk etc. Panama imported around $2.38 billion of various textile products during 2015.

The global medical textiles market is expected to reach USD 20.23 billion by 2022,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c. The rise in the number of elderly population, ongoing technological advancements and increase in health consciousness are fueling the growth of global medical textiles market.

Consumers buying home goods and apparels in the USA may be looking more closely at product origins, and could demand more transparency. Thirty percent of Americans said that they would completely stop purchasing a brand if they made a false product claim about a bedding/clothing product being 100 per cent organic, 100 per cent Pima cotton, or other claim of this type, etc.
